Written Answers. - National Schools Management.

85.

asked the Minister for Education if she will outline the respective roles and responsibilities in national schools of (a) the principal teacher (b) the chairperson of the board of management and (c) the board of management itself.

The principal teacher has overall responsibility subject to the authority of the board of management — for the day to day activities of the school. This includes responsibility for the organisation of school work, keeping of records and control of the pupils and the teaching-staff.

The chairperson presides at meetings of the board of management and acts on the board's behalf in relation to a wide variety of functions.

The board of management is charged with the direct government of the school, the appointment of teachers, subject to the Minister's approval, their removal and the conducting of the necessary correspondence.

Further information about the roles and responsibilities of these parties are contained in the handbook "Boards of Management of National Schools: Constitution of Boards and Rules Procedure". I have arranged for a copy of this handbook to be placed in the Oireachtas Library.
